Overview
A hyperspectral microscope integrates traditional microscopy with hyperspectral imaging technology, allowing for the capture of both spatial and spectral data from a sample. This advanced tool is particularly valuable in fields requiring detailed material or biological analysis, such as pharmaceuticals, nanotechnology, and biomedical research. The technology behind hyperspectral microscopy enables researchers to identify and quantify chemical compositions at a microscopic level, providing insights that are not possible with conventional microscopy alone. Its ability to detect subtle spectral variations makes it indispensable in quality control and research applications.
Structure and Working Principle
A hyperspectral microscope consists of several key components: a high-resolution optical microscope, a hyperspectral imaging sensor, and specialized software for data analysis. The microscope captures detailed images, while the hyperspectral sensor records spectral information across multiple wavelengths. The working principle involves illuminating the sample with a broad-spectrum light source. The reflected or transmitted light is then split into its constituent wavelengths by a diffraction grating or prism. The resulting spectral data is processed to create a hyperspectral image cube, which contains both spatial and spectral dimensions.
Key Features
Hyperspectral microscopes are distinguished by their high spectral resolution, enabling the detection of minute chemical differences within a sample. They also offer high spatial resolution, allowing for detailed imaging at the microscopic level. Another notable feature is the integration of advanced software for data processing and visualization. This software often includes tools for spectral unmixing, classification, and quantitative analysis, making it easier for researchers to interpret complex data.
Application Areas
Hyperspectral microscopes are widely used in material science for analyzing the composition and structure of materials. In biology, they help in studying cellular and tissue samples, providing insights into disease mechanisms and drug interactions. In the medical field, these microscopes are used for diagnostic purposes, such as identifying cancerous tissues. Environmental scientists also utilize them for monitoring pollutants and studying ecological samples.
Maintenance and Precautions
Regular maintenance of a hyperspectral microscope is essential to ensure optimal performance. This includes cleaning optical components, calibrating the system, and updating software. Precautions should be taken to avoid exposing the microscope to extreme temperatures or humidity, which can damage sensitive components. Proper handling of samples is also crucial to prevent contamination or damage to the microscope's optics.
